Essential Responsibilities:

  • Develop conceptual intersection layouts, schematics, signal timings, and engineering reports.
  • Strive to achieve proficiency in the software tools currently utilized by the firm, and conduct analyses using Vistro, Sidra, Synchro, and SimTraffic.
  • Create signing and pavement marking plans.
  • Work closely with engineers and designers to research, analyze, and address complex transportation challenges.
  • Develop Transportation Demand Management plans.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ant Local, State, and Federal design and zoning standards and regulations.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ering or equivalent in relevant work experience.
  • Experience in transportation engineering or traffic engineering.
  • Exposure to Synchro, Vistro, Sidra, or SimTraffic.
  • In possession or pursuit of EIT
  • Passion for collaboration throughout the development and execution of projects.
  • Excellent organizational skills.
